About J. T. Chesterman

J. T. Chesterman is a scholar working on Gastroenterology, Anesthesiology and Pain Medicine and Surgery, having authored 19 papers that have together received 292 indexed citations. Recurring topics across this work include Congenital Diaphragmatic Hernia Studies (4 papers), Cardiac Valve Diseases and Treatments (3 papers) and Esophageal and GI Pathology (3 papers). The work is most often cited by research in Paleontology (97 citations), Archeology (8 citations) and Space and Planetary Science (8 citations). J. T. Chesterman has collaborated with scholars based in United Kingdom, United States and Oman. Frequent co-authors include Colin Renfrew, M. J. Aitken, W Whitaker, John B. Das, C. S. Darke, Calum Harvey and D. Michael G. Beasley. Their work appears in journals such as Thorax, British journal of surgery and American Heart Journal.
